Lieferkettensorgfaltgesetz (LkSG) Compliance-Kosten
Definition
The Supply Chain Due Diligence Act (LkSG) requires confectionery manufacturers to implement comprehensive auditing and documentation systems. Search results indicate these compliance measures create 'significant investments' particularly for small and medium enterprises (SMEs), who lack dedicated compliance departments. Manual document management, supplier verification loops, and audit trail creation drive overhead costs.
